Journalism student talks about dams at Fishin' Club
January 5, 2012 · 8:12 AM
Sam Lungren will give a presentation on the removal of the Elwha River dams at the Fishin’ Club’s meeting at 7 p.m. Thursday, Jan. 5 at the M-Bar-C Ranch in Freeland.
Lungren will discuss the history of the dams, the fight to get rid of them and the future designs to restore the salmon to the upper river. A 2007 graduate of South Whidbey High School, he studied journalism at Gonzaga University and wrote his undergraduate thesis on the issue.
Lungren is now pursuing a master’s degree in environmental journalism at the University of Montana. As an avid steel-head and salmon fisherman, he is elated to one day ply this river that has been buried for so many years.
